Keane To Open For U2!


Keane have confirmed they will also be playing dates with U2 on the "Vertigo Tour" this summer. The band, who had a massive year in 2004 and have been sweeping awards ceremonies recently, will be main support to U2 at shows in Munich, Nice, Barcelona and Lisbon. Already confirmed to play with U2 at other shows in Europe are The Killers and Snow Patrol. Too bad they won't open for U2 in the U.S.!

DualDisc


For those that went to the concession stands after the concerts, you may have noticed the DualDisc recordings of "Hopes And Fears." On one side of the disc is the CD audio, while on the other side of the disc is the DVD video. I bought one at the Boston show in February for $20.00, which also included an album sleeve signed by Tom, Tim, and Richard. Not a bad deal!

Pictures Of New Video


At keanemusic.com, they have pictures from the new videoshoot for "Everybody's Changing." As reported earlier, it was filmed in Chicago last week by Mark Pellington, who has made videos for other bands including the great U2.

Brits 25


Keane won 2 Brits awards, Best Album and Best Breakthrough Act of 2005. Congratulations!
